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03279979 835 5678
20937508 332563734 022
20937508 332563734 022
5036817 81251 347883690 78
All about undefined
Interested in learning more?
20937508 332563734 022
5036817 81251 347883690 78
See more
921 9702772
67 991377752 570940810
See more
230611381 87 303
37350026994 068901 904
See more